Practical Designer Notes for Real Business Use

Before finalizing Pretend I m a Fire Truck for a project, test it on real packaging mockups to see how it translates in print. Check its black and white usage to ensure it remains effective without color. Preview it on small labels to confirm readability and clarity.

Test it with your brand colors to ensure it complements your existing palette. Compare it with competitor packaging to avoid visual similarity. Review PNG transparency and inspect SVG or vector editability for scalability. Also, check how it looks beside different font styles—serif, sans serif, script, handwritten, or display fonts.

Finally, always confirm the commercial license before using it for client work, business branding, or physical product sales. This ensures you’re compliant and protected when integrating the design into your workflow.
